Abstract

591,458. Automatic control systems. VAPOR CAR HEATING CO., Inc. Aug. 16, 1944, No. 15634. Convention date, Aug. 9, 1943. [Class 38 (iv)] Temperature.-A thermostat, responsive to a space temperature subject to automatic control by mechanism adjusted at upper and lower temperature limits of a temperature range, has an auxiliary electric heater and means to vary the heating current to change the effective relation between the temperature range and the temperature of the space without change in the range. A mercury column control thermostat 17, Fig. 1, has contacts 29, 30 respectively causing the opening of a relay 18 and the closing of a relay 19. These relays when closed energize a reversible motor 15 in series which increase and decrease respectively the heat applied to the space in which the thermostat 17 is installed. The range of temperature between contacting at 29 and 30 is fixed by the construction of the thermostat but current supplied to a heating winding 27 may be varied to change both effective temperatures equally by adjusting a series resistance 23 or a shunt resistance 21. When relay 18 operates by contact at 29 a resistance 20 is connected in parallel with resistance 21 to increase the heating of coil 27 and when relay 19 is operated by closure .at contact 30 all auxiliary heat is removed by opening of the back contact of this relay and intermittent action of the relays and motor 15 results. Fig. 1 shows a master thermostat 16 also subject to the space temperature. This thermostat has an auxiliary-heater and a contact 25 adapted to place a resistance 22 in shunt with its heater and causes intermittent closure at contact 25. The heating circuits of both thermostats are in series so that the master thermostat adjusts the mercury in the control thermostat except when above contact 30 and below contact 29 while the control thermostat adjusts the mercury in the master thermostat. Fig. 1 shows the motor 15 adjusting a damper 14 determining the relative proportions of cooled and heated air directed into a space. Figs. 2 and 3 (not shown) relate to the application of the invention to the control of a damper regulating the flow of air through a casing surrounding a cooling coil in an oil circulating system associated with an engine crank case, the master and control thermostats being responsive to the temperature in the circulating pipe. The higher temperatures involved necessitate higher currents in the auxiliary thermostat heaters and a relay is interposed in the heater circuits to present destructive sparking at the upper contacts of the thermostats. Fig. 4 (not shown) illustrates a modification of the system of Fig. 1 having no master thermostat.
